COVID-19 rages across the United States as the number of people who have died from the virus in the country closes in on 400,000.

While the last week here in Washington has been dominated by the attack on the U.S. Capitol and the impeachment of President Trump for the second time, the country continues to battle a COVID-19 crisis.

The number of those dying from the virus across America is staggering. Over the last week, the daily average of new cases being reported is around 250-thousand. More than 23 million people in the U.S. have been infected so far.
